News

Investors have so far behaved as if they’re counting on the U.S. president to back down, having seen previous U-turns from ...
President Donald Trump has announced he’s levying tariffs of 30% against the European Union and Mexico starting Aug. 1 ...
Canada faces another set of tariffs in its ongoing trade talks with the U.S. However, in this latest round of tariff ...
Gold prices rose for a third straight session on Friday, as U.S. President Donald Trump's announcement of new tariffs on ...